🚩 No Social Proof
Search for “LCTFIX reviews” on Trustpilot, Google Reviews, or Better Business Bureau. If you find only 5-star reviews with generic text (“great service, fast withdrawal”), they are likely fake. Real platforms have a mix of good and bad feedback.
